Brute Force should have never hit the shelves. I would give a quick synopsis of the storyline, but quite frankly, I couldn't tell what in the world was going on. I know this much- The main character, Tex, was killed, so they cloned him and you play as his clone. Weird, I know.

There are three other characters that fight alongside you. It is easy to get lost and the controls are so out of wack that it's hard to fight the enemies that blend in perfectly with the surroundings.

You fight on different planets fighting reptile-like beasts, protecting the native inhabitants along the way. Actually killing an enemy is insanely easy, but finding them is the hard part. Like I said earlier, it is easy to get lost aas the levels are not clear and linear. If I wanted to play a puzzle game, I'd go with Zelda or an Rpg, not a shooter being compared with Halo.

I was dissapointed, as I'm sure almost everyone else who played this game was. This will go in the records as a flop folks. A big flop.

My final word-It is a clunky game, I wouldn't play it again, and my advice to you is not to play it either.
